In the ever-evolving music technology landscape, the demand for professionals with a strong foundation in music tech skills is on the rise. This section showcases the primary roles and their respective relevance in the industry for those pursuing a Certificate in Music Tech for Visionaries. 1. **Sound Designer** (25%): Sound designers craft and produce audio elements for various media, including video games, films, and commercials. They blend technical skills with musical creativity to create captivating sonic experiences. 2. **Music Software Developer** (30%): Music software developers are responsible for creating, maintaining, and improving music-related applications. They combine programming expertise with musical knowledge to develop innovative tools that cater to the needs of musicians, producers, and educators. 3. **Audio Engineer** (20%): Audio engineers manage the recording, mixing, and mastering processes for music, podcasts, and other audio content. They ensure the highest audio quality, whether working in a studio or remotely. 4. **Music Data Analyst** (15%): Music data analysts harness the power of data to help artists, labels, and streaming platforms make informed decisions. They collect, process, and interpret data related to music consumption, audience demographics, and marketing campaigns. 5. **Music Tech Entrepreneur** (10%): Music tech entrepreneurs create, manage, and scale businesses that innovate the music technology industry. They combine their passion for music with a strong understanding of the technology landscape and the ability to lead teams.
